 Abstract   In this paper we present modeling and analysis of permanent magnet brushed DC motor (PMBDCM). A finite element modeling (FEM) technique is used to predict the motor performance and calculate the important parameters such as the armature inductance and airgap flux. The armature inductance is important , because of its effect on the machine performance when the motor is supplied from a phase-controlled converter or chopper. An experimental work has been carried out for a motor type PM3-CLW of 2.4 A and 4000 rpm to verify the FEM results.
